  • Patent number: 4209909
    Abstract: Styluses defining a hinge axis in a dental articulator are received in guide block pathways defined by side walls and a curved upper wall. The blocks are rotatably mounted to vary the slope of the upper wall. A supply of guide blocks is provided having a medial wall with a rear curved portion which varies for different blocks based on average values. The user selects the blocks having the desired medial wall to provide the desired side shift. In one arrangement, the side walls are formed as a unit and removeably mounted on the upper wall and the user selects the side wall unit from a supply of units providing different degrees of side shift movement. In another form, the medial wall is transversely adjustable.

  • Patent number: 4126938
    Abstract: An upper frame including parallel side arms is supported on the patient's ears and attached to a transverse rod supported on the bridge of the patient's nose. A record plate depends from each side arm overlying each of the patient's temporomandibular joints. A lower frame is attached to the lower jaw by means of an adjustable clutch. Adjustable side arms carrying movable styluses engage the record plates on the upper frame. Movement of the styluses over the record plates is monitored to obtain measurements of the joint movements. A tooth separator swingably mounted on the transverse rod of the lower frame separates the rear teeth slightly when the jaw movements are being measured. After the hinge axis position has been located on the record plates, an adjustable straight edge is utilized to indicate the true horizontal plane of reference formed by the two hinge axis points and the point on the patient's nose.

  • Patent number: 4034475
    Abstract: Jaw movements are measured mechanically and electrically. The information is used to adjust guide boxes on a dental articulator which cooperate with fixed styluses to simulate jaw movements. The information is also used to select preformed guide blocks with fixed walls. Such preformed guide blocks are adjustably mounted which causes change of the orientation of the fixed walls. Also disclosed is a hinge bracket for use in positioning preformed guide blocks for simple hinging action in an articulator. Further disclosed is a pair of alignment members having laterally extending openings which facilitate lateral adjustment of an articulator upper frame on fixed styluses of a lower frame.

  • Patent number: 3947964
    Abstract: A transparent plastic block into which jaw movement information is to be drilled is formed with a small diameter hole perpendicular to the recording surfaces of the member to serve as an index to the accuracy of the recording operation. Score lines on the recording surfaces intersecting the hole center line serve as a further accuracy guide. Score lines on the surfaces of the member facilitate observation of the information recorded in the member.

  • Patent number: 3946489
    Abstract: A dental clutch member molded in the form of a thin-walled shell fits over the person's lower teeth and is attached thereto by plaster. Holes in the walls of the shell help the plaster become firmly attached to the shell. Support structure molded integral with the shell extends outwardly through the patient's mouth for receiving a horizontal rod to which is attached other dental apparatus. Fracture lines in the shell and the extension permit the shell to be broken into pieces to facilitate removal of the clutch from the patient. One or more tooth separators are molded with the clutch member and then broken away from the shell to be releasably attached to the clutch by detent buttons.
